Incorporate almonds into your diet

 We all know that eating almonds have plenty of health benefits, but can they really help with weight loss? The answer is a resounding yes!  There are quite a few ways to incorporate almonds into your diet that will help you lose weight. One of the easiest and most accessible options is simply eating them as a snack. You can keep a bag of almonds in your purse or desk at work so that they are always readily available. They’re also easy to eat on the go because they don’t need any preparation and don’t require utensils to eat. The best part is since almonds have so few calories, there’s no guilt when you want to snack on them!  Another way to incorporate almonds into your diet is by using them in recipes. Almond milk is one of the healthiest alternatives to dairy milk, makes a great addition to smoothies and other treats. You can also make cakes, muffins, sweet potato fries, and more with almonds! The best part about almonds is that they are super cheap! You’ll never have to worry about spending too much money on this superfood. Almonds really do offer everything you could possibly need in a healthy snack or ingredient, without breaking your budget. Almonds can be as versatile as any other nut–try them roasted with rosemary, or chopped up in a smoothie. Almonds can also be used in place of some ingredients that you’d normally use nut flour for. They are similar to most nuts when it comes to cooking, so feel free to experiment!
